[PATCH v4 05/16] pwm: lpss: Use pwm_lpss_apply() when restoring state on resume

2020-07-08 Thread Hans de Goede
Before this commit a suspend + resume of the LPSS PWM controller would result in the controller being reset to its defaults of output-freq = clock/256, duty-cycle=100%, until someone changes to the output-freq and/or duty-cycle are made. This problem has been masked so far because the main
